metalMnSeBr is a ternary halide compound combining manganese, selenium, and bromine—a material class of emerging interest in solid-state chemistry and materials research. This compound belongs to the broader family of metal halides and chalcohalides, which are primarily investigated for optoelectronic, photovoltaic, and semiconductor applications rather than established industrial production. While not yet widely deployed in commercial applications, manganese halides and related ternary compounds are of research interest for potential use in next-generation perovskite alternatives, photon conversion devices, and radiation detection systems where the combination of heavy elements and halide frameworks offers tunable bandgap properties.
